Aim: To enable the students to analyse a business idea based on their knowledge within a number of relevant techincal, legal and economic fields.
Contents: The course comprises lectures within a wide array of subjects. Headlines for these are:
- The business objectives
- Product description
- Patents and licenses
- Market analysis
- Marketing/Market economy
- Production on type of business (legal)
- Economic analysis
- Financing the company start-up
- Hiring/Firing (legal aspects)
- The enviroment internal and external.
Parallel with the course the students in groups of 4-6 have to work out a business plan for a specific product idea. At the end of the course the business plan has to be presented orally to the coordinator of the course and the censor.
